Reminder - if schools close - courts/gov admin buildings close. We encourage employers in Broward/Palm Beach to err on the side of caution and allow staff to make necessary preparations, including receiving loved ones who are evacuating Milton's path from the West Coast.

The School District of Palm Beach County continues closely monitoring and preparing for Hurricane Milton as it approaches Florida. The School District remains in contact with local emergency management officials. As a result, we are implementing operational changes this week to prioritize the safety of students, families, and staff.

Tuesday, October 8:
All District-operated schools and offices remain open tomorrow, Tuesday, October 8. After-care programs at elementary and middle schools will remain operational. Other after-school events, club meetings, athletics, facility leases, and adult education programs are canceled tomorrow, Tuesday, October 8.

Wednesday, October 9, and Thursday, October 10:
All District-operated schools and offices will be closed Wednesday, October 9 and Thursday, October 10. Extracurricular activities, after-care programs, sports, school meetings, and other on-campus events are also canceled Wednesday, October 9 and Thursday, October 10. All facility leases are also canceled Wednesday, October 9 and Thursday, October 10. School District employees should closely monitor communications from the District and their supervisor. Employees should not report to work unless otherwise directed by their supervisor.

Friday, October 11:
District-operated schools and offices are expected to reopen and resume normal operations on Friday, October 11.

All families and staff are encouraged to be prepared for the potential impacts from Hurricane Milton by visiting floridadisaster.org/planprepare/ and continuing to monitor announcements from the Palm Beach County Emergency Operations Center.

Additional updates to School District operations will be sent to families and staff as well as posted to our website and social media.

We are a boutique, fast-paced, deadline oriented and established federal practice seeking to add an associate attorney to our team.

Qualifications for this position include:
- 1 - 3 years of litigation experience preferred but not required
*** 3L's who are awaiting their bar results this month may apply*** - we are willing to train the right candidate
- Licensed member of the Florida Bar and in good standing (Admission to FLSD preferred but not required)
- Strong legal research and excellent writing skills, as well as possess strong/persuasive oral advocacy (must submit writing sample with resume for consideration)
- Desire to excel and work your way up the ranks of the law firm - we are looking for an associate who can 2nd chair and potentially 1st chair jury trials
- Ability to provide excellent customer service to our clients, with a client first mindset
- Must be a self-starter and goal-oriented with a focus on long-term career goals
- Must be competent & proficient in the use of Word, Microsoft Office & Excel

Essential Duties & Responsibilities:
- Draft/review substantive pleadings and motions
- Complete/submit forms, questionnaires and reports (EEOC / Dept. of Labor)
- Respond to motions
- Draft and Respond to Discovery
- Attend/chair hearings, depositions, mediations, meetings with clients, as well as negotiate settlements
- Communicate in a highly effective manner with team members and clients
- Ability to work in a fast paced evolving environment managing several scheduling orders and pre-trial deadlines

Benefits:
- Competitive Salary
- Bonuses
- Health Insurance
- 401K

Mr. Amit is the founding partner of The Firm. He prides his practice on primarily representing businesses and their owners and management in employment and contractual disputes, as well as ADA access matters. His practice specializes on Labor and Employment Law, handling cases under the Fair Labor Standards Act (FLSA), Florida Minimum Wage Act (FMWA), Title VII discrimination, the Florida Civil Rights Act (FCRA), the Age Discrimination in Employment Act (ADEA), the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A), and the Family Medical Leave Act (FMLA), as well as other federal, state and local laws governing the relationship with employees.

Drawing from his vast experience handling dozens of matters in federal court and successfully leading jury trialsin federal court, in addition to litigating disputes, Mr. Amit also focuses on crafting employee policies and modifying clients’ practices that will stand the tests of local, State, and federal regulations, to minimize and mitigate risks for future disputes.

A native of Israel, after completing his military service, Mr. Amit graduated from Florida International University and the University of Miami School of Law. He is admitted to practice in the State of Florida and in front of the United States Court for the Southern District of Florida and The United States Court for the Middle District of Florida. Mr. Amit has been recognized by his peers and selected as a Rising Star in the 2010 – 2012, 2014-2017 editions of Florida Super Lawyers.
